Harvard Bioscience
Harvard Bioscience is a global developer, manufacturer and marketer of a broad range of specialized products, primarily apparatus and scientific instruments used to advance life science research at p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, universities and government laboratories worldwide. We sell our products to thousands of researchers in over 100 countries through our full-line catalog (and various other specialty catalogs), our websites, and through distributors, including GE Healthcare,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c., and VWR. We have sales and manufacturing operations in the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, and Spain and sales facilities in France and Canada.
